Immersion: Why Not Try Free Voluntary Reading?
Krashen, Stephen
Mosaic: A Journal for Language Teachers, v3 n1 p1,3-4 Fall 1995
Suggests that reading is a powerful source in acquiring language competence. The author argues that children do not enjoy grammar instruction, but love to hear stories and read books that they select on their own. Given the lack of clear evidence for focusing on form, it is concluded that free reading should be an option for immersion children. (21 references) (Author/CK)
